Barcelona Guide

Barcelona combines singular architecture, Mediterranean neighborhoods, beaches, markets, and late-night dining in a city that works best when major sights are reserved in advance.

Best Time To Go

May through June and September through October balance beach weather with better walking conditions. Peak summer is crowded and hot, while winter is quieter and still useful for architecture and food.

How To Plan It

Four days works well: one Gaudi-focused day, one old-city and waterfront day, one neighborhood and food day, and one Montjuic, beach, or day-trip plan.

Where To Stay And Move

Eixample is the easiest all-around base, Gracia feels more residential, and the Gothic Quarter is atmospheric but busy. Metro and walking cover most plans; keep valuables secure in crowded areas.

Food And Budget

Use markets for browsing rather than assuming every stall is a bargain. Mix tapas bars, neighborhood menus, seafood, and one destination meal, then leave room for the city's late dining clock.

CountrySpain
FoundedAbout 15 BC
PopulationAbout 1.69M
Metro AreaAbout 5.47M
Density43,465 per sq mi / 16,782 per sq km
Area39 sq mi / 101 sq km
City figures cover the municipality; metro figures cover the wider Barcelona urban region.
